Can We Trust Lisa Brown & Betsy Wilkerson to Keep Us Safe?

SPOKANE, WA - The Spokane Good Government Alliance released the following statement today, kicking off a new campaign that asks Spokane voters to consider a simple question:

“Can we trust Lisa Brown and Betsy Wilkerson to keep us safe?”

“Public safety is on the ballot this year,” said John Estey, Executive Director of the Spokane Good Government Alliance. “Lisa Brown and Betsy Wilkerson may give lip service to ‘public safety’ but Spokane voters deserve to know their real records. They both support policies that will make Spokane less safe.”

Spokane residents will recall Lisa Brown used her position at the Washington State Department of Commerce to give taxpayer dollars to an organization that bails repeat offenders out of jail. Brown also has a long history of funneling her failed congressional campaign funds to support “Defund the Police” candidates for public office and even hired staff who advocate for defunding the police on her Mayoral campaign.

During the City Council meeting on September 26, 2022, Betsy Wilkerson voted to defund police drug investigations. Spokane Police Chief Meidl pleaded with Council to not pass an ordinance removing funds that the department relies on for drug investigations.  He noted “we had a 600% increase in overdose deaths… We’ll have to stop drug investigations” if Council took action to defund their investigations.  Despite hearing this testimony, Councilwoman Wilkerson still voted to pass an ordinance that would bankrupt the fund used for these drug investigations.

“Voters have a clear choice this November. There is a reason why the Spokane Police Guild and Sheriff John Nowels did not endorse Lisa Brown, Betsy Wilkerson, or anyone on their slate of candidates - their records of supporting defunding the police and making our community less safe is bad for Spokane. Voters are entitled to know their record” Estey concluded. 

The Spokane Good Government Alliance was formed in 2019 to advocate for a balanced local government that best serves the Citizens of Spokane.
